www.northantstelegraph.co.uk— Cultural projects across the county are in with a chance of being awarded a share of £5m as part of a government funding project looking to uplift local organisations. North Northamptonshire Council (NNC) was provisionally offered the funding through the government’s Levelling Up Fund as part of the Spring Budget. A number of new and improved bus services across north Northamptonshire will be phased in over the coming months, after plans to create better connectivity across the county were announced. The Department for Transport (DfT) has allocated North Northamptonshire Council (NNC) just over £2m to fund phase three of its Bus Service Improvement Plan (BSIP) in 2024/25.
